1. Disconnect the emergency release cord
The emergency release cord is a red cord that hangs from the garage door’s trolley. The cord is the manual release that disconnects the door from the opener, allowing you to lift it by hand. A power cord is useful in a power outage or emergency because it bypasses the automatic system and lets you open or close the door manually. To unlock the door, find the red rope and pull it down and back, away from the door. The door should disengage, allowing you to open it.

4. Call a professional
If none of the above works, it’s best to call a professional garage door service company to evaluate the situation. They will be able to diagnose and fix any issues that may be preventing you from opening the door. It is important to avoid forcing the door open as this can cause serious damage to both the door and the opener.
